Student-athletes at Villanova University are giving back in a powerful way. Through a mentorship program with Radnor Middle School, they're helping young boys gain confidence and see what they're capable of.
One of those students, 13-year-old Jaylen Bostick, said the program changed how he thinks about school and his future.

"I thought I would just go to high school and slack off," Jaylen said. "But now, I'm getting into a lot of honors. My grades are so much better than they were. Going on to high school, I plan to keep these good grades."
